Transaction cdd6f14895fddbc9f769ab0e03f30068d725fc2a20dbaaac98bad1ea602829c6
1 Input
1 Output
-
cdd6f14895fddbc9f769ab0e03f30068d725fc2a20dbaaac98bad1ea602829c6:0
- value
- 599903
- script pubkey
- OP_0 OP_PUSHBYTES_20 3adbb81594f35ecd6223fd284b4b1cc23fdb4da6
- address
- ltc1q8tdms9v57d0v6c3rl55ykjcucglakndxc5wlys